I am using an ADG719 analog switch (see circuit). I have a fixed voltage of 4.5V on an input and 0V on the other. I am switching between the inputs at 125kHz. If I look at the switch output I see some form of transient behavior (see image). It takes about 150us before the output values are in a steady state. Before that the values seem to ramp up (if you look at the top cursor the first values are at a lower level than the later ones). Does anyone know what would cause this? I am guessing it must be something to do with the input of the buffer amplifier on the switch output.
